Smart Arranging Solutions



Carrying out smart sorting systems changes rubbish collection by simplifying the procedure and enhancing efficiency. These systems utilize sophisticated technology to automatically sort recyclables from basic waste, reducing contamination levels and boosting the quantity of product that can be recycled. By incorporating sensors and artificial intelligence, smart sorting systems can determine different kinds of products, such as plastics, glass, and paper, with impressive precision.

Autonomous Garbage Trucks



Changing waste collection, Autonomous Trash Trucks are altering the game with their innovative modern technology. These self-driving lorries navigate areas successfully, lowering human mistake and enhancing garbage collection routes. Outfitted with advanced sensing units and AI systems, they can detect obstacles, pedestrians, and other lorries, guaranteeing secure procedures.

Autonomous Rubbish Trucks offer numerous advantages. They help reduce traffic jam and exhausts by complying with the most efficient courses. Furthermore, these automobiles operate silently, reducing noise pollution in residential areas during morning collections. With the capability to work around the clock, they boost the performance of waste monitoring services.

One crucial benefit of Autonomous Waste Trucks is their prospective to improve employee safety and security. By automating the collection procedure, these vehicles lower the risks associated with hand-operated garbage collection, such as injuries from heavy training or mishaps on busy roads.

As innovation remains to progress, these innovative lorries are positioned to change the waste management market, making trash safer, a lot more efficient, and eco-friendly.

One more strategy is gasification, which transforms waste right into artificial gas that can be used for power generation or as a chemical feedstock.

Additionally, anaerobic digestion breaks down natural waste to generate biogas for power.

Applying WtE technologies can help in reducing greenhouse gas emissions, lower dependence on fossil fuels, and reduce the ecological impact of waste disposal.
